|
@@ -213,6 +213,16 @@ namespace MySystem.Controllers
|
|
|
// }
|
|
|
// }
|
|
|
// db.Dispose();
|
|
|
+ DateTime start = DateTime.Parse("2025-01-01 00:00:00");
|
|
|
+ Models.KxsMain.WebCMSEntities db = new Models.KxsMain.WebCMSEntities();
|
|
|
+ List<Models.KxsMain.ChangeTypes> brands = db.ChangeTypes.ToList();
|
|
|
+ List<Models.KxsMain.UserAccountRecord> records = db.UserAccountRecord.Where(m => m.CreateDate >= start && m.ChangeType > 300).ToList();
|
|
|
+ foreach(Models.KxsMain.UserAccountRecord record in records)
|
|
|
+ {
|
|
|
+ string name = brands.FirstOrDefault(m => m.Id == record.ChangeType).Name;
|
|
|
+ PrizePushHelper.Instance.Do(DateTime.Now.ToString("yyyyMMddHHmmssfff") + function.get_Random(8), name, record.ChangeType.ToString(), record.ChangeAmount, record.UserId, "{\"brand_id\":101,\"user_id\":" + record.UserId + "}");
|
|
|
+ }
|
|
|
+ db.SaveChanges();
|
|
|
return "ok";
|
|
|
}
|
|
|
|